Why Should You Earn an AWS Certification?
AWS Certified Solutions Architect - Associate certification validates the technical skills needed to design distributed applications and systems on the AWS platform. In addition, AWS Certified Developer - Associate certifies the fundamental technical skills needed to build applications on AWS.
AWS Certified SysOps Administrator - Associate is a vendor-neutral certification that enables you to administer and troubleshoot complex, production-level systems built on AWS.
